2006 TIUA Summer TOEFL Course

Description
In this four-week course, students practice all sections of the TOEFL--Listening, Structure, Reading, and Vocabulary. There is a balance between work on exercises and classroom instruction. Students are encouraged to ask questions and to learn how to analyze all of the specific kinds of test items. In addition to practice tests, students take an official TOEFL at the end of the course. There is no additional charge for this TOEFL for those enrolled in the course.

Course includes three hours of instruction per day, from 9:00 am to 12:00 pm, Monday - Friday. An afternoon section is possible if there is enough demand. If there are students working in Kaneko Day Camp, classes will be from 1:00-4:00pm the week of Kaneko Day Camp (August 7-11).
